Tesla Model 3 to embark on grand 9,400-mile journey using printed solar panels

Teslarati

A team of scientists from the University of Newcastle in Australia will be using a Tesla Model 3 as a means to test printed solar panels that they believe could be the next big thing in affordable, sustainable solutions. The printed solar panels would be rolled out beside the Tesla Model 3 to soak up the sunlight.

DOE awards $56M to 21 concentrating solar power projects; $8M for reducing soft costs of rooftop PV systems

Green Car Congress

The US Department of Energy (DOE) will award $56 million over three years—subject to congressional appropriations—for 21 total projects to further advance advanced concentrating solar power technologies (CSP). CSP awards. These systems can be combined with existing fossil-fuel plants to allow for flexible power generation.
